Google employed Florina Montenescu revealed (H/T: 9to5google) That Android 16S Desktop mode is based on Samsung’s basis:
We have collaborated with Samsung, and built on the basis of Samsung Dex, to bring improved desktop window functions in Android 16, for more powerful workflows for productivity.
It is unclear whether Google copies/pastes dex into Android 16 Or if the two companies create a developed version for Android 16 by using Samsung’s knowledge accrued over the years. We have asked Google to clarify the statement and will update the article as soon as the company gives us an answer.
In any case, Google’s decision to merge with Samsung on Android’s Desktop mode is smart. Samsung first introduced Dex to Android back in 2017, giving users an experience of PC style when their phones were connected to an external screen. So Galaxy Maker has plenty of expertise in this area.
This news is following a leak that suggests that Dex in one Ui 8 Be able to take some signals from Android 16s Desktop mode. In any case, we are happy to see a proper stationary mode in stock Android after all this time.
